From the configuration tab be sure you have already selected "Rx Serial" and the correct
provider (e.g. SPEKTRUM2048 for DSMX)
In the CLI tab type "set spektrum_sat_bind = 9" for DSMX or "set spektrum_sat_bind = 5" for
DSM2.
Type "save" and after the Piko reboots remove the USB cable to power off the Piko.
Wait a second and reconnect the USB cable. After cold start satellite led should start blinking
and transmitter should be turned on while pressing the bind button.
After binding the satellite led should be solid. Connect the configurator again and use the
receiver tab to test that satellite is working correctly.
The final step is to go to CLI tab and type "set spektrum_sat_bind = 0" and then type "save". This
must be done so that satellite doesn't go back to binding mode when the Piko is repowered
again.
g. Next click on the receiver tab. You need to confirm all controls are assigned correctly, and
moving in the correct directions.
Turn on your transmitter, and wait for your satellite LED to indicate connected. If this does not happen,
you will need to re-bind your receiver. If you are using a satellite, it will be powered from your computer
USB during setup.
Channel assignments:
- In the channel map box select the drop down for JR/Spektrum/Graupner
- Now click ‘save’
- Check everything works as expected.
